Nektar++
 All Classes Namespaces Files Functions Variables Typedefs Enumerations Enumerator Properties Friends Macros Pages
Nektar::LibUtilities::CommMpi Member List

This is the complete list of members for Nektar::LibUtilities::CommMpi, including all inherited members.

AllReduce(T &pData, enum ReduceOperator pOp)Nektar::LibUtilities::Comm
AlltoAll(T &pSendData, T &pRecvData)Nektar::LibUtilities::Comm
AlltoAllv(Array< OneD, T > &pSendData, Array< OneD, int > &pSendDataSizeMap, Array< OneD, int > &pSendDataOffsetMap, Array< OneD, T > &pRecvData, Array< OneD, int > &pRecvDataSizeMap, Array< OneD, int > &pRecvDataOffsetMap)Nektar::LibUtilities::Comm
Bcast(T &data, int rootProc)Nektar::LibUtilities::Comm
Block()Nektar::LibUtilities::Comminline
classNameNektar::LibUtilities::CommMpistatic
Comm(int narg, char *arg[])Nektar::LibUtilities::Comm
Comm()Nektar::LibUtilities::Commprotected
CommCreateIf(int flag)Nektar::LibUtilities::Comminline
CommMpi(int narg, char *arg[])Nektar::LibUtilities::CommMpi
CommMpi(MPI_Comm pComm)Nektar::LibUtilities::CommMpiprivate
create(int narg, char *arg[])Nektar::LibUtilities::CommMpiinlinestatic
Exscan(T &pData, const enum ReduceOperator pOp, T &ans)Nektar::LibUtilities::Comm
Finalise()Nektar::LibUtilities::Comminline
Gather(const int rootProc, T &val)Nektar::LibUtilities::Comm
GetColumnComm()Nektar::LibUtilities::Comminline
GetComm()Nektar::LibUtilities::CommMpi
GetRank()Nektar::LibUtilities::Comminline
GetRowComm()Nektar::LibUtilities::Comminline
GetSize()Nektar::LibUtilities::Comminline
GetType() const Nektar::LibUtilities::Comminline
m_commNektar::LibUtilities::CommMpiprivate
m_commColumnNektar::LibUtilities::Commprotected
m_commRowNektar::LibUtilities::Commprotected
m_rankNektar::LibUtilities::CommMpiprivate
m_sizeNektar::LibUtilities::Commprotected
m_typeNektar::LibUtilities::Commprotected
Recv(int pProc, T &pData)Nektar::LibUtilities::Comm
RemoveExistingFiles(void)Nektar::LibUtilities::Comminline
Scatter(const int rootProc, T &pData)Nektar::LibUtilities::Comm
Send(int pProc, T &pData)Nektar::LibUtilities::Comm
SendRecv(int pSendProc, T &pSendData, int pRecvProc, T &pRecvData)Nektar::LibUtilities::Comm
SendRecvReplace(int pSendProc, int pRecvProc, T &pData)Nektar::LibUtilities::Comm
SplitComm(int pRows, int pColumns)Nektar::LibUtilities::Comminline
TreatAsRankZero(void)Nektar::LibUtilities::Comminline
v_AllReduce(void *buf, int count, CommDataType dt, enum ReduceOperator pOp)Nektar::LibUtilities::CommMpiprotectedvirtual
v_AlltoAll(void *sendbuf, int sendcount, CommDataType sendtype, void *recvbuf, int recvcount, CommDataType recvtype)Nektar::LibUtilities::CommMpiprotectedvirtual
v_AlltoAllv(void *sendbuf, int sendcounts[], int sensdispls[], CommDataType sendtype, void *recvbuf, int recvcounts[], int rdispls[], CommDataType recvtype)Nektar::LibUtilities::CommMpiprotectedvirtual
v_Bcast(void *buffer, int count, CommDataType dt, int root)Nektar::LibUtilities::CommMpiprotectedvirtual
v_Block()Nektar::LibUtilities::CommMpiprotectedvirtual
v_CommCreateIf(int flag)Nektar::LibUtilities::CommMpiprotectedvirtual
v_Exscan(Array< OneD, unsigned long long > &pData, const enum ReduceOperator pOp, Array< OneD, unsigned long long > &ans)Nektar::LibUtilities::CommMpiprotectedvirtual
v_Finalise()Nektar::LibUtilities::CommMpiprotectedvirtual
v_Gather(void *sendbuf, int sendcount, CommDataType sendtype, void *recvbuf, int recvcount, CommDataType recvtype, int root)Nektar::LibUtilities::CommMpiprotectedvirtual
v_GetRank()Nektar::LibUtilities::CommMpiprotectedvirtual
v_Recv(void *buf, int count, CommDataType dt, int source)Nektar::LibUtilities::CommMpiprotectedvirtual
v_RemoveExistingFiles(void)Nektar::LibUtilities::Commprotectedvirtual
v_Scatter(void *sendbuf, int sendcount, CommDataType sendtype, void *recvbuf, int recvcount, CommDataType recvtype, int root)Nektar::LibUtilities::CommMpiprotectedvirtual
v_Send(void *buf, int count, CommDataType dt, int dest)Nektar::LibUtilities::CommMpiprotectedvirtual
v_SendRecv(void *sendbuf, int sendcount, CommDataType sendtype, int dest, void *recvbuf, int recvcount, CommDataType recvtype, int source)Nektar::LibUtilities::CommMpiprotectedvirtual
v_SendRecvReplace(void *buf, int count, CommDataType dt, int pSendProc, int pRecvProc)Nektar::LibUtilities::CommMpiprotectedvirtual
v_SplitComm(int pRows, int pColumns)Nektar::LibUtilities::CommMpiprotectedvirtual
v_TreatAsRankZero(void)Nektar::LibUtilities::CommMpiprotectedvirtual
v_Wtime()Nektar::LibUtilities::CommMpiprotectedvirtual
Wtime()Nektar::LibUtilities::Comminline
~Comm()Nektar::LibUtilities::Commvirtual
~CommMpi()Nektar::LibUtilities::CommMpivirtual